Output d091269309b88e7643500438709069ca3bb2d570f5b8e2f30e7852177b12435e:43

value
1049744
script pubkey
OP_HASH160 OP_PUSHBYTES_20 722aafa4aa51d51d49a9a13791b4e94c2bbf9a9c OP_EQUAL
address
3C6g6J4vSHY1duQrc5EFVAwCuMsYpeiX5X
transaction
d091269309b88e7643500438709069ca3bb2d570f5b8e2f30e7852177b12435e
confirmations
170437
spent
true